Number 251

Number 251 is a prototype classical mandolin, an attempt at duplicating the flat-top sound of the best classical instruments, with a crisp, fast attack, but with improved structural integrity from features like modern two-way truss rod, zero fret, adjustable and removable neck joint allowing you to adjust the string height, side port, etc. It has a thread-through bridge assembly which exerts almost no down-pressure, allowing an ultra light lattice-braced flat top for quick response. The shorter scale, 13.2", is similar to the classical standard. A deep three-piece body emulates the bowl-back sound, and elevated arm rest and pick guard keep you from touching the sound board and reducing its vibration. Materials include curly maple body, European spruce top, flat fret board, ebony and rosewood trim, and Rubner tuners. I believe it is very successful and similar to classical instruments, bright with a little more sustain. Definitely not a bluegrass sound with prominent mid-range.
